1) Mindee's mum going to pick LO up tue afternoon for MMR jab & planning on bringing straight back to me, is that ok?

2) A neighbour made a comment the other day that at their nursery they have a policy whereby any more than 2 runny/loose nappies & they are sent home incase they are coming down with a bug.

Anyone else have a policy anything like this?

I must say does sound quite appealing to me because I never know if its because of a bug or not, therefore the child ends up staying & I spend the day cleaning up sh*tty nappies.

hi, these are just my opinions but i'd say taking the baby back after the MMR is ok as it tends to take a few hours to sink in - find out if she's had any calpol etc and tell mum you'll have to call her at any signs of a temperature.
and as for the runny nappies - i personally wouldn't do it, my LO gets runny nappies every time he's teething.

i'd say its fine to come back after the jab but i'd give her an hour to check all is ok no reactions etc.
and the runny nappies i dont unless they are obviously unwell but my doctor says that anymore than 2 runny nappies classes as diaorrhea, and obviously there is meant to be a 24/48 hour exclusion for this.
